Vincent Pilette serves as CEO of Gen Digital, formed through the 2022 merger of NortonLifeLock and Avast that created the world's largest pure-play consumer cybersecurity company. The combined entity serves over 500 million users across a portfolio of trusted brands: Norton (the iconic consumer antivirus and security brand), Avast (one of the world's most downloaded free antivirus products), AVG (free antivirus), LifeLock (identity theft protection and monitoring), and CCleaner (PC optimization). Gen Digital's business model is predominantly subscription-based, with high recurring revenue and strong free cash flow generation. The company converts free antivirus users (particularly from Avast and AVG's massive freemium base) into paying subscribers by upselling premium security, identity protection, VPN, and privacy features. This freemium-to-premium conversion pipeline is a unique growth lever. The consumer cybersecurity market benefits from structural growth drivers: increasing online threats (ransomware, phishing, identity theft), growing awareness of privacy risks, expanding digital footprints (smart homes, IoT devices), and the trend toward comprehensive digital protection bundles that combine security, identity monitoring, VPN, and password management. Key stock drivers include paid subscriber growth, average revenue per user (ARPU), conversion rate of free users to paid, LifeLock identity protection demand, churn rates, competitive dynamics against McAfee, Bitdefender, and built-in OS security (Windows Defender, Apple), and the pace of Avast integration synergies.
